Police in Bensalem, Bucks County are trying to put together information on a shooting at the Grandview Apartments, on the 900 block of Bristol Pike.  A shooting happened in the parking lot of the apartment complex about 7:30 PM. A male then got into a white passenger car and then fell out of the vehicle,  near  route 13.witnesses said. He kept saying that he was shot. As bystanders tried to help him,  cops were on the way, with EMS.

The suspects got away. They are described as three black males on bikes. There was no indication on a direction of travel, or description of the males or the bikes, at this time.  There were initial reports of another person shot, but that was unfounded.  Police have closed the 900 block of Bristol Pike to traffic.  The condition of the shooting victim is unknown.  Jefferson Hospital, Torresdale Division is under two miles away from the shooting.

UPDATE: The victim, died from his injuries.  He was identified as 26 year old Tevon Hill, from Wingohocking Street in  Philadelphia
